Asian Stocks Rise on Hopes of Eased U.S.?China Chip Restrictions

Add to Favorite
Added to Favorite


Most Asian markets climbed on Tuesday, buoyed by optimism from ongoing U.S.?China trade negotiations and reports that President Trump may roll back chip export curbs on Beijing. The advance followed a modestly positive Wall Street session, where S&P?500 futures jumped 0.5% amid buzz over potential tech?export concessions.
Trade Talks Inject Fresh Risk Appetite
High?level talks in London kicked off Monday, and President Trump signaled the discussions “went well” and would continue on Tuesday. According to The Wall Street Journal, Trump has empowered Treasury Secretary Scott?Bessent to negotiate easing some recent restrictions on semiconductors and related technology exports—an olive branch intended to persuade China to lift its rare?earth export limits in return.
Regional Index Moves

Shanghai Shenzhen CSI?300: +0.2%

Shanghai Composite: +0.1%

Hang Seng: +0.1%

What to Watch Next:

Tuesday’s Trade Talks: Any statement from Trump or Chinese delegates can quickly reverse or bolster today’s gains.

U.S. Consumer Inflation (Wed): A hotter print could prompt Fed?pause doubts, undercutting risk assets; a softer result would reinforce dovish expectations.

Rare?Earth Dynamics: Watch for Chinese policy updates on critical minerals, which remain central to tech?supply chains and the broader trade calculus.
